Boschetto di pini marittimi embodies the enchanting presence of Rome's iconic maritime pines, most notably the majestic umbrella pines. These characteristic trees, with their distinctive flattened canopies, create a serene and picturesque atmosphere that is instantly recognisable and deeply woven into the city's character. Such groves offer a tranquil escape from urban activity, providing refreshing shade and contributing significantly to the Eternal City's unique landscape.

Exploring these pine-filled areas allows visitors to appreciate the breathtaking views these venerable trees afford across Rome's historical vistas and natural settings. Many of these beautiful trees feature in various parks, alongside ancient avenues and at archaeological sites, enhancing the scenery. The umbrella pines are not only visually striking but also play an important ecological role, contributing to air quality and offering a habitat for diverse wildlife, while their pine nuts are a valued element of local cuisine.
